Feb. 20 (UPI) -- Police in Mississippi shared video of officers capturing a 4-foot alligator that was found running loose in a residential neighborhood.
The Moss Point Police Department said officers responded to a neighborhood in the Barnes Road area this week on a report of a small alligator wandering through yards.
A video shows officers using a catch pole to capture the baby gator while it attempts to hide under an SUV in a resident's driveway.
Lt. Henry Bouganim, the officer who conducted the capture, said he was only a little worried about the danger from the small alligator during the operation.
